The seemingly random path of the disc in plinko is, in reality, governed by the laws of physics, albeit in a complex and chaotic manner. Each collision with a peg imparts a change in direction and velocity, and the angles of these collisions are influenced by the peg's placement and the disc’s momentum. While it is impossible to predict the exact trajectory with certainty, understanding the basic principles can give players a slight edge. The initial drop point is crucial; a central drop generally leads to a more even distribution of possible outcomes, while an off-center drop tends to favor the corresponding side. This isn’t a guarantee, of course, but a statistical tendency.
The arrangement of the pegs is a fundamental aspect of plinko. The density of pegs, their spacing, and any subtle variations in height all contribute to the overall probabilistic landscape. A tighter peg configuration will result in more frequent collisions, leading to a more randomized outcome. Conversely, wider spacing allows for more direct paths, potentially favoring certain prize slots. Operators often adjust the peg configuration to fine-tune the payout distribution, potentially increasing the house edge or creating more attractive odds for specific prizes. The randomness is carefully calibrated to maintain player engagement while ensuring profitability.

Despite its inherent randomness, plinko can create an illusion of control for players. The ability to choose the drop point and potentially influence the disc’s trajectory can give the impression that skill plays a role, even though luck is the dominant factor. This illusion can be particularly persuasive, leading players to believe that they can improve their odds through careful observation and strategic decision-making. This is a common phenomenon in many forms of gambling, where players often overestimate their ability to predict or influence the outcome. The degree of engagement with the cascading disc creates a sense of participation and an investment of mental effort – reinforcing the perception of control.
